Web12 de abr. de 2024 · Each Quicken file is separate. If you start a new file, the data including all the accounts and transactions you entered in the old file is still there, but you can't access it from the new file. You would have to open the old file to see the data that you entered there. It is like having two separate Word documents. WebQuiffen is a Python package for parsing QIF (Quicken Interchange Format) files. The package allows users to both read QIF files and interact with the contents, and also to create a QIF structure and then output to either a QIF file, a CSV of transaction data or a pandas DataFrame. Web30 de set. de 2024 · To do that, you start the task manager (in Win 11, you have to do that through Ctrl-Alt-Del and click the task manager option) and look for tasks (usually only one or two) that start with "Quicken…", click each task and press the "End Task" button. After that (at least my version of) Quicken will restart normally.
